2013-07-24 23 views
0

我有一個搜索按鈕,可以在按鈕單擊時找到特定的文本。現在我想讓用戶搜索的文本不是整個文本。我該怎麼做?這是我的搜索代碼。如何高亮datagridview列中的部分文本?

private void button7_Click_3(object sender, EventArgs e) 
{ 
    string filterBy; 
    filterBy = "Stringtext Like '%" + textBox6.Text + "%'"; 
    ((DataTable)dataGridView1.DataSource).DefaultView.RowFilter = filterBy; 
} 

有什麼想法嗎?

+0

如果你想在你輸入的時候進行搜索(如Google)。看看這裏http://www.codeproject.com/Articles/138595/Search-As-You-Type-in​​-C# –

回答

1

我不認爲這個功能可用於winform控件,但DevExpress有這個控件SearchLookUpEdit,這正是你想要實現的。見here

+0

謝謝,但我做手動使用油漆.. :) – soldiershin